Job Description
Job Title: Warehouse Operative
Duration: 3 Months – Possibility of extension
Pay Rate: £12.21 per hour
Location: York
Hours: Shifts available are: 06:00-14:00 / 13:30-22:00 / 21:00-06:00, These can be any 5 days in 7 and rota is month by month
This is an exciting opportunity to join a team that work in a very past paced environment but gives you the opportunity to learn new skills and work in different departments.
The role is picking and packing customers' orders. Your job is to inspect merchandise and products to ensure you have the right item quantities and that nothing is missing per order.
Main Duties and Responsibilities:
- Ensuring working practices comply with Food Safety principles.
- Adopting safe working practices by adhering to Health & Safety guidelines and policies and procedures in all areas.
- Ensuring that working processes are complied with, in line with the contract specification and requirements.
Your role will include:
- Tray Setting – Ensuring correct quantities of trays are prepared as per orders.
- Deliveries – Checking goods in, storage of goods and delivering orders.
- Returns and Recycled – Ensuring the return of customer products and equipment.
Requirement:
- You must be able to provide 3 years of checkable employment references. (Any gaps over 28 days to be accounted for with a reference)
